
Best Practices for Minimizing Habitat Disruption
1. Environmental Impact Assessment
- Conduct Thorough Site Analysis: Before installing solar panels, conduct a comprehensive environmental impact assessment to identify potential habitats of sensitive species. This includes evaluating the presence of wildlife corridors, wetlands, or protected habitats within or near the proposed solar project area.
2. Optimize Site Selection
- Choose Sunny Locations with Minimal Environmental Impact: Select sites with high sunlight availability and minimal environmental risks, such as areas with relatively flat land and few water features or flood risks. This helps avoid disrupting sensitive ecosystems and reduces the need for expensive mitigation measures.
3. Avoid Critical Habitats
- Avoid Sensitive Habitats: Ensure that solar projects are not located in habitats that are crucial for local species. This may involve avoiding areas with critical ecological functions, such as migratory pathways, nesting sites, or feeding grounds.
4. Implement Best Management Practices
- Use Best Management Practices: Implement practices that minimize habitat disruption during construction, such as minimal grading, protecting existing vegetation where possible, and using temporary fencing to prevent wildlife encroachment during construction phases.
5. Stormwater Management
- Effective Stormwater Management: Develop and implement effective stormwater management plans to prevent erosion and water quality impacts on nearby habitats. This may involve installing sediment traps or vegetated buffers to protect waterways.
6. Monitoring and Mitigation
- Monitor Environmental Impacts and Implement Mitigation Strategies: Regularly monitor the solar site for environmental impacts and implement mitigation strategies if adverse effects are observed. This can include creating habitat restoration plans or implementing additional measures to protect wildlife.
By following these guidelines, the environmental impact of solar panel installation can be minimized while ensuring effective energy production.
